Ingredients

15 mins
16 servings
  1. 3 cupFlour
  2. 1 cupsugar
  3. 1 cupbutter
  4. 1/4 tspsalt
  5. 1regular sugar or clored sugar for sprinkling before baking

Cooking Instructions

15 mins
  1. 1

    in a large mixing bowl, beat butter, sugar and salt until creamy and a pretty pale color.

  2. 2

    carefully blend in flour until just mixed. dough will be really tacky and wwet looking. thats ok. wrap dough in plastic wrap and refridgerate for 30 minutes to an hour

  3. 3

    carefully roll or pat out dough on a floured surface to 1/4 to 1/2 inch thick. cut with a round cutter or glass dipped in flour. you should be able to get 8-10 from the first roll. gather dough and repeat.

  4. 4

    sprinkle your reaining sugar or sprinkles after placing them on the baking sheet. bake at 350°F until they are a pale golden brown. let cool on the cookie sheet for 5 mins then move to a cookie sheet. enjoy
